Advanced Certificate in Heritage Digitization: Best Practices
-- viewing nowThe Advanced Certificate in Heritage Digitization: Best Practices is a comprehensive course designed to equip learners with essential skills for the growing field of heritage digitization. This program emphasizes the importance of preserving cultural heritage through modern digital techniques, adhering to best practices and ethical considerations.
